North Dakota Eyes Crypto and Gold to Combat Inflation

North Dakota Considers Diversifying State Assets into Crypto and Precious Metals

In a bid to mitigate the impact of inflation on its finances, the state of North Dakota is exploring the possibility of diversifying its assets into cryptocurrency and precious metals. A resolution drafted by state legislators seeks to encourage the State Treasurer and State Investment Board to invest selected state funds in digital assets and precious metals.

The Resolution: A Response to Economic Uncertainty

Resolution 3001, introduced by a bipartisan group of representatives and senators, acknowledges the responsibility of the State Treasurer and State Investment Board to safeguard the state’s financial resources against the impacts of inflation and other economic uncertainties. The resolution urges these entities to respond to changing economic conditions by investing the state’s finances in a prudent manner. By doing so, the state aims to protect its purchasing power and ensure the long-term sustainability of its finances.

A Growing Trend in the United States

North Dakota is not alone in its consideration of cryptocurrency as a strategic investment opportunity. Several other states, including Florida, Texas, Pennsylvania, Ohio, and New Hampshire, are also exploring the possibility of establishing strategic Bitcoin reserves. Additionally, Louisiana has already begun accepting payments for services in Bitcoin and the USDC stablecoin. This growing trend reflects a broader recognition of the potential benefits of diversifying state assets into digital currencies.
